well, the headphone thing sounds like a bad solder joint on one end. Have you tried a different pair of headphones?

if you're using a mixer in your equation, yes make sure you hard pan L/R those individual channels ON THE MIXER depending on where you intend for them to record at. Pan them left, they go to channel 1 on the Mbox...pan them Right, channel 2 on the Mbox.
Then in Pro Tools create a stereo track and assign it's inputs to Channel 1/2 and record arm it. You should then hear and see the meters moving on both L/R channels on the stereo track in PT. Are the meters moving? Is the output of the stereo track set to Output 1/2?
Are there headphone inputs on the mixer itself....have you tried listening to that to see if you hear true L/R signal? What about speakers...do you have some speakers to plug into the Mbox outputs?

I'm just trying to see if it's a heaphone problem, headphone output problem, input problem, or operator error.
